Sometimes, when I awaken in the morning, I am too tired or in too much pain to say my prayers. But I still say them. I thank God for another beautiful day that He gives me here on this earth because, any day, I might be going home to my eternal life.

When I sit alone with my thoughts, He comes very strong after I pray. I do not know how or when they will come to me but I always thank God for them blessings, even when I am selling my Street Sense papers.

When I was growing up, my father always taught us how to pray, especially before we would go to bed. I really miss him. May he rest in peace. As I get older, I love praying a lot more. It has kept me strong in my faith. It also makes me stronger to go to church and praise God.

My mother and father raised us right and made sure we had food to eat, clothes on our bodies and a roof over our heads. I try to follow everything my parents taught me, especially to have respect for others. Even though I have been through a lot of ups and downs, including long periods of homelessness, I praise and thank God for the strength to lead me through those times. So, always keep your trust in God. Amen.
